This model is as close to the one we bought that I can find on Amazon. Ours is a GE Profile PFSS2 with filtered water and built in icemaker. It's stainless steel and matches everything else on this mode. The adjustable shelves are what makes this a great fridge. You decide how much space between shelve both inside and on the doors. So that you can make small condiment shelves and then have lots of room for big bottles. Under on of the shelves is a rack which holds twelve cans of soda, just like the ones in the market; it's angled so they flow forward as you pull each can out. All the shelves are on wheels and pull out, making it easy to find what your looking for.
There are lights placed all around the inside of the fridge so there are no dark spots where the light is blocked by a 2 liter bottle or a casserole dish. The bins are mostly see through so that you can find what you want without having to open them. There's one shelf that splits in half allowing you to put tall bottles on the shelf below without having to shift shelves around.
Only two complaints: 1) the filtered water is great if your right handed but is impossible to use left-handed (just a bunch of right handed bigots)
2) the off-switch for the in freezer ice-maker is located behind the bin that holds the ice and is awkward to get to; don't think they expect you to use it much
All in all we are quite pleased with the visual effect of having most of what you want right at eye level.
